The Thang

Two blocks of Possum iron. Timer at 50 seconds on, 15 seconds rest, three exercises through four cycles, about 15 minutes a block. Each block owns its gear the whole time, so the men rotate and the weights stay put.

  • Block 1 — Chest Press with the 50lb KB, American Hammers with the 25lb KB, Squats with the 40lb DBs.

  • Block 2 — Sandbag Rut-Rows, Norma Jean Rileys on the ab roller (say the name before you can come up), Weighted Lunges with the 30lb DBs.

Slot Machine and YHC opened on Block 1 while Nemo and 16-bit took Block 2, then the groups swapped and everybody got both.

There was a Block 3 in the bag — Hammer Swings, Box Cutters and KB Swings — but at four PAX it stayed in the bag. That is by design. The plan scales on headcount, not on how much any one man does.
